Job Description

Job Summary

The Office Manager is responsible to managing the daily workflow of a variety of documentation and related computer information as well as such tasks as greeting visitors, answering phones, and providing additional support to other departments as directed by the General Manager.

Essential Duties/Responsibilities

Nothing in this job description restricts management's right to assign or reassign duties and responsibilities to this job at any time.

  • Manages and/or performs functions of plant office including accounts payable, sales, payroll, local HR functions, personnel records, safety program record keeping, fleet performance and inventory records, product quality and the general clerical functions of operations; serves as liaison with Corporate Office on administrative matters.
  • Responsible for maintaining proper flow of information from plant to Corporate Office in compliance with established laws, regulations, and procedures; maintains required records in accordance with established procedures; maintains office supplies and equipment.
  • Handles a variety of purchasing-related functions in the Oracle system, including the issuance of purchase orders, processing raw material receipts, payroll functions, etc.
  • Regularly works on the computer for purposes of inputting, maintaining and/or transferring data to our Corporate Offices; includes inputting HRIS information into Oracle as well as handling other computer-related needs for the facility such as finished product shipments documentation.
  • In larger operations, supervises clerical staff persons engaged in data entry, reception and other clerical support activities; in smaller operations, performs all tasks associated with the plant office.
  • Responsible for being familiar with and observing all company safety rules and regulations; recognizes that safety is top company priority; attends regularly scheduled safety meetings.
  • All other duties as assigned.
